Battery

A battery is the source of power for the motor of a mobility scooter. The scooter is simple to drive and can be driven through your neighborhood or even outside. A scooter can last for up to 24 hours, depending on the model. However, the battery's lifespan is different and is dependent on the frequency you use the scooter, the type of scooter and how well you maintain it.

The life of the battery in scooters is influenced by the speed at which you drive as well as the size and weight of the driver, and any additional weights like shopping bags or luggage. Bursts of acceleration can drain batteries faster than driving at a steady pace, and steep incline drives and heavy loads will reduce the battery's lifespan faster. Extreme heat and cold, and other environmental factors can harm and decrease the battery's lifespan.

Mobility scooters come with different types of batteries. These include lithium iron phosphate batteries (LiFePO4) and nickel manganese copper (NMC) and others. Lithium iron phosphate batteries typically have the longest life but they are also more expensive than other battery options. No matter what type of battery, all can be improved by taking proper care of them. Keep them charged regularly, store them in a dry, cool location, and don't leave them without charge for long periods of time.

Do not let your batteries completely discharge. A deep discharge will significantly reduce your battery's lifespan. To avoid this it is recommended that you make use of smart chargers that automatically shut off when batteries are fully charged.

A good quality battery should last between 300-500 full charge cycles before it loses its potency and starts to fail. You can extend the life of this cycle by using your scooter for a few trips each day, and allowing time to cool down after each excursion. It is also helpful to fully charge the batteries before every use, since this will give them an extra energy boost.

The best way to select the right scooter for you is to figure out the place you'll use it the most frequently. For instance, if anticipate mainly indoor use, three-wheel models are generally lighter and more mobile than four-wheel models. They are also designed to be more easily fit through narrow spaces and doors.

If you are planning to ride your scooter on uneven surfaces or outside the added stability and security of four-wheel models could be extremely beneficial. These models have bigger tires and suspension systems that are more robust. They also have higher incline ratings. These features let the scooter traverse rough terrain or grass, as well as gravel with ease while providing the most comfortable ride.

Four-wheel scooters are more stable than three-wheelers. This is a great feature for those who have balance issues, or who have difficulty distributing their weight evenly. Four-wheel scooters are also known to have a slight increase in weight capacity and speed capabilities, making them more suitable for long distances regularly.

The size of the scooter has an impact on its overall comfort level. A smaller model can be easier to navigate through tight spaces and crowded areas, while larger models are better suited for outdoor or oversized indoor areas.
